Winding Road published this fairly interesting system by which they rate a car's speed index by looking at the HP, weight, and price. Speed per dollar. They don't figure in handling into it, but none the less my fairly stripped MCS figured at about 2800 garnering a 5th place behind the EVO and ahead of the Corvette.
